引言

在这个数字货币迅速发展的时代,更多的人开始关注虚拟币的存储和管理,其中钱包节点的创建就显得尤为重要。那么为什么我们需要一个虚拟币钱包节点脚本呢?这不仅关系到资产的安全性,还涉及到对整个区块链网络的支持。你是不是也想了解如何创建一个安全、可靠的虚拟币钱包节点脚本呢?

什么是虚拟币钱包节点?

如何创建最安全的虚拟币钱包节点脚本:新手指南

虚拟币钱包节点是一种用于存储和管理加密货币的程序。它不仅可以保存你的资产,还能够参与区块链网络的维护和交易记录的验证。通过运行节点,你不仅可以独立管理自己的资产,还可以帮助整个网络的安全和稳定性。因此,了解如何创建一个节点脚本对于任何希望深入了解虚拟币的用户来说都是至关重要的。

为什么选择运行自己的钱包节点?

选择运行自己的虚拟币钱包节点是一个重要的决定,它带来了诸多好处。首先,安全性是最显而易见的好处。通过自己的节点,你不必再依赖第三方钱包服务,这样可以减少被黑客攻击的风险。其次,运行节点可以使你更深入地了解区块链技术及其运作原理。你可能会好奇,这是否会使你在数字货币投资中更加得心应手呢?

基础知识:节点脚本的构成

如何创建最安全的虚拟币钱包节点脚本:新手指南

在动手编写虚拟币钱包节点脚本之前,我们首先要了解节点脚本的基础构成。通常情况下,一个节点脚本会包含以下几个部分:

  • 区块链节点设置:这部分代码负责初始化和配置区块链网络连接。
  • 钱包功能:用于生成和管理钱包地址、私钥和交易。
  • 网络交互:处理区块链数据的收集和发送。
  • 用户界面:根据需要,提供一个友好的界面,帮助用户进行交互操作。

创建虚拟币钱包节点脚本的步骤

那么,如何具体实施呢?我们可以将创建虚拟币钱包节点脚本的过程分为以下几个主要步骤:

步骤 1:选择编程语言

在开始编写脚本之前,第一步是选择一种适合的编程语言。Python、JavaScript和Go是常用于编写节点脚本的语言。你是否有考虑过哪种语言更加适合你的需求和技能呢?同时,你也可以根据社区支持和资源的丰富程度来决定。

步骤 2:环境搭建

选择好编程语言后,你需要搭建开发环境。这通常包括安装相应的编译器、构建工具和库。确保你的环境可以顺利运行与你所选择的虚拟币相关的代码。

步骤 3:编写节点连接代码

连接到区块链网络是节点脚本的关键部分。你需要使用API或RPC来连接到网络,并确保获取最新的区块和交易数据。这时候,你可能会开始思考:其实理解这些数据的流动与交易的本质,真的很有趣,对吗?

步骤 4:实现钱包功能

实现钱包功能意味着编写代码来生成钱包地址和管理私钥。切记,私钥是一种敏感信息,你的安全性和资产安全性都依赖于它。为此,建议采用加密方式来存储和处理私钥。你是否会考虑如何更好地保护这些关键数据呢?

步骤 5:网络数据交互

在这一部分,你需要处理从网络获取到的数据,并进行必要的解析与验证。确保你的节点可以及时同步区块数据,这不仅有助于资产的安全性,也决定了你参与网络的有效性。

步骤 6:用户界面

最后,你可以考虑为用户设计一个简单的交互界面,使得操作更加直观。是否觉得这个步骤是提升用户体验的重要环节呢?界面可以使用Web技术或桌面应用程序来实现,具体取决于你的用户需求。

安全性与维护

创建虚拟币钱包节点脚本后,安全性和维护成为了新的挑战。确保你的节点始终更新,并修补可能的安全漏洞是维护的核心工作。你会问,是否有必要定期审查和更新代码呢?当然,有效的维护可以延长节点的运行寿命,确保你的资产安全。

总结

在虚拟币的世界里,创建一个自己的钱包节点脚本可以使你获得更高的安全性和对资产的控制。在这个过程中,选择合适的编程语言、搭建开发环境、编写节点连接代码、实现钱包功能等步骤都是至关重要的。同时,思考如何提高安全性和进行维护,也是确保你在这一领域成功的关键。你是不是也对此充满期待呢?或许,通过不断的实践和探索,你会成为这个数字货币世界中的一名出色的参与者。

希望这篇文章能帮助到你,激发你对虚拟币钱包节点脚本的兴趣,让你在数字货币的投资中更加自信和从容。